S/O Thomas Jefferson Weatherly & Eliza Jane Danforth

Married to Eungenia A Cahoon November 25, 1896 at Fredericktown, Missouri

Obituary:
Weatherly - Robert Homer, on December 1, at the New York Hospital, beloved husband of Eungenia (nee Cahoon) and loving father of Thomas L, and Mrs. Valentine Hattemer; last residence, 270 Park Ave., New York City, but formerly lived at 265 Lyncroft Road, New Rochelle, New York. Services at the Funeral Church, Madison Ave. and 81st St., on Friday, December 4, at 2 P.M. Please omit flowers. St. Louis and New Rochelle papers please copy.


Obituary 2:
Robert H. Weatherly

President of Locomotive Valve Gear Concern for 30 Years

Robert Homer Weatherly of 270 Park Avenue, since 1912 president of the Pilliod Company, 30 Church Street, manufacturers of valve gears for locomotives, died yesterday afternoon in the New York Hospital at the age of 68.

Born in Charleston, MO., he was graduated from Washington University in St. Louis and for many years made his home in that city. From 1925 until a month ago he resided at 265 Lyncroft Road, New Rochelle, New York. Mr. Weatherly belonged to the Railroad Club, Wykagyl Country Club and Westchester Hills Country Club.

He leaves a wife, Eugenia; a daughter, Mrs. Valentine P. Hattemer; a son, Tom Weatherly, and two grandchildren, Valentine P., Jr., and Robert Hattemer.
